Electrical properties of niobium-doped titanium dioxide: 2: Equilibrium kinetics

Article Abstract:

The isothermal gas/solid equilibrium kinetics for Nb-doped Ti[O.sub.2] is reported at elevated temperatures within narrow ranges of oxygen activity and the equilibrium kinetics is monitored using electrical conductivity measurements. The chemical diffusion coefficient in strongly reduced conditions has exhibited negative temperature dependence, indicating that under these conditions transport in a chemical potential gradient is consistent with metallic charge transport.

Reversible redox processes of poly(anilines) in layered semiconductor niobate films under alternate UV-Vis light illumination

Article Abstract:

The hybridization of the poly(anilines) (PANI) guest species incorporated within layered [K.sub.4][Nb.sub.6][O.sub.17] to form anisotropically oriented polyaniline/niobate (PANI/NbO) hybrids are reported. The hybrids are observed to exhibit efficient photoinduced redox reactions accompanied by reversible photochromic properties.
